ConfiguringtheDaikinENVi Thermostat
Reminders&
Alerts
Low Temp Alert
Sets the temperature at which the thermostat will generate a Low Temperature Alert. The
range can be:
Disabled – No alert will be generated.
Enabled - Set temperature range of 35 to 68 °F (1.5 to 20 °C).
High Temp Alert
Sets the temperature at which the thermostat will generate a High Temperature Alert. The
range can be:
Disabled – No alert will be generated.
Enabled - Set temperature range of 60 to 104 °F (15.5 to 40 °C).
Display Alerts on Thermostat
Select No if you do not want any of the alerts to be displayed on the Daikin ENVi thermostat
screen. Alerts will continue to be displayed on the web portal and sent via email.
Enable Heating/Cooling Alerts
Select No to disable alerts for heat/cool error conditions. If disabled, alerts indicating that the
system failed to heat or cool will not be appear in the screen, web portal, or emails.
Reminders and Alerts: Menu > Reminders and Alerts
The system service (maintenance) reminder generates an alert telling the homeowner that regularly scheduled maintenance is required. This
reminder, along with technician contact information, can be displayed on the screen. If homeowners register their thermostats, the reminders will be
emailed to them and be displayed in the web portal. You can set the Last Service date, turn the Reminder On or Off, and to set the Frequency of the
maintenance interval in months.
